Abstract

(13)C/(12)C ratios have been determined for plant tissue from 104 species representing 60 families. Higher plants fall into two categories, those with low delta(PDBI) (13)C values (-24 to -34 per thousand) and those with high delta (13)C values (-6 to -19 per thousand). Algae have delta (13)C values of -12 to -23 per thousand. Photosynthetic fractionation leading to such values is discussed.
